Description
Eurogenes K3 analyzes modern European autosomal variation by modeling an individual's genome as a mixture of three regional components: South_Baltic, North_Baltic, and Northwest_Euro. Designed for researchers, genealogists, family historians, and ancestry enthusiasts with European roots, this calculator reduces complex genome-wide data into an accessible three-way profile that emphasizes major geographic and historical gradients across Northern and Western Europe. Using curated reference panels that represent Baltic-adjacent populations and a northwest European cluster, Eurogenes K3 estimates the proportional contribution of each component to a user’s DNA. It is optimized for modern-era samples and is especially useful when recent historical population structure (rather than deep ancient splits) is the primary interest. Outputs report percent contributions from each reference group and are presented in clear, comparison-ready form to facilitate family comparisons, regional affinity mapping, and population-level surveys. Genetic and historical context: the three components capture major clines shaped by postglacial expansions, Neolithic farming dispersals, and subsequent Bronze Age and historic movements that reshaped northern and western Europe. North_Baltic typically peaks in Scandinavia and northeastern plains, South_Baltic is enriched along southern Baltic littoral zones, and Northwest_Euro reflects coastal and Atlantic-adjacent western European ancestries. These components are statistical clusters reflecting similarity to reference samples, not immutable ethnic labels; they summarize ancestry signals in a compact way. Why use Eurogenes K3? It delivers a fast, intuitive snapshot of north–south and Baltic–Atlantic axes, making it ideal when a concise, interpretable breakdown is preferred over highly fragmented models. Reference Populations

South_Baltic

  • Description: This region primarily includes populations from countries like Poland, Lithuania, and Latvia. Populations here have been significantly influenced by Slavic, Baltic, and Germanic ancestries, resulting in a rich blend of cultural and genetic backgrounds.

North_Baltic

  • Description: Encompassing areas such as Estonia and parts of Finland, populations from the North Baltic region are characterized by a combination of Fenno-Ugric and Baltic ancestries, with distinctive genetic markers that set them apart from their southern neighbors.

Northwest_Euro

  • Description: This region generally includes populations from nations such as the United Kingdom, Ireland, and parts of Scandinavia. The Northwest European genetic landscape is shaped by Celtic, Norse, and Germanic ancestries, reflecting historical migrations and cultural exchanges.

What is Admixture Analysis?

Admixture analysis is a method used to estimate your genetic ancestry by comparing your DNA to reference populations from around the world. Think of it as creating a recipe of your genetic makeup, where the ingredients are different ancestral populations.

This calculator uses 3 carefully selected modern populations as references, allowing for a detailed breakdown of your genetic heritage.
